Current Versus Historical Henderson, NV Rents

Henderson rentals average $1,375 for a studio rental to $3,300 for a 4-bedroom rental. The median price of all currently available listings is $2,350, or roughly $1 per square feet.
For the apartment units and housing in May 2024, median rents have risen substantially over the last year. Studio rentals prices have increased by $458 (54.46%) year-over-year from $842 to $1,300. 1-bedroom rentals prices have increased by $460 (33.60%) year-over-year from $1,369 to $1,829. 2-bedroom rentals prices have increased by $202 (11.87%) year-over-year from $1,698 to $1,900. 3-bedroom rentals prices have increased by $119 (5.56%) year-over-year from $2,132 to $2,250. 4-bedroom rentals prices have increased by $369 (13.52%) year-over-year from $2,731 to $3,100. Note that this figure includes all active and rented listings throughout the month.
Month-to-month, seasonality might have a bigger impact than overall trend price changes. Studio rents have gone up by 6.12% this month. 1-bedroom rents have gone up by 11.30% this month. 2-bedroom rents have gone up by 5.65% this month. 3-bedroom rents have gone up by 3.13% this month. 4-bedroom rents have gone up by 4.49% this month.

What is the average rent price in Henderson, NV?
The average monthly rental price for Henderson, NV apartments for rent is approximately $2,350. This calculation takes into consideration rental listings of varying bedroom/bathroom sizes, building types, and locations.
Do Henderson, NV rent prices drop in winter?
Yes! On average we see a 3.4% drop in rental prices between the peak summer months and the slower winter months. With the added bonus of decreased competition from other renters looking to move, winter is generally considered the best time of the year to find an apartment for rent in Henderson, NV.
